Robinet \u00e0 bille \u00e0 tourillon<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"h-1-1-what-is-a-trunnion-mounted-ball-valve\">1.1 Qu&#039;est-ce qu&#039;un <a href=\"https:\/\/zecovalve.com\/fr\/produit\/trunnion-mounted-ball-valve\/\" target=\"_blank\" rel=\"noreferrer noopener\"><mark style=\"background-color:var(--base)\" class=\"has-inline-color has-contrast-2-color\"><strong>Robinet \u00e0 tournant sph\u00e9rique mont\u00e9 sur tourillon<\/strong><\/mark><\/a>?<\/h3>\n\n\n\n<p>Le robinet \u00e0 tournant sph\u00e9rique mont\u00e9 sur tourillon est un type de robinet \u00e0 tournant sph\u00e9rique, \u00e9galement appel\u00e9 robinet \u00e0 tournant sph\u00e9rique fixe. Le bal du&nbsp;<a href=\"https:\/\/zecovalve.com\/fr\/products\/trunnion-mounted-ball-valve.html\/\">robinet \u00e0 boisseau sph\u00e9rique mont\u00e9 sur tourillon<\/a>&nbsp;est fixe et ne bouge pas lorsqu&#039;on appuie dessus. Les robinets \u00e0 tournant sph\u00e9rique mont\u00e9s sur tourillon sont \u00e9quip\u00e9s d&#039;un si\u00e8ge flottant. Sous l&#039;action de la pression moyenne, le si\u00e8ge se d\u00e9placera pour que la bague d&#039;\u00e9tanch\u00e9it\u00e9 appuie fermement sur la sph\u00e8re pour assurer l&#039;\u00e9tanch\u00e9it\u00e9. Les roulements sont g\u00e9n\u00e9ralement install\u00e9s sur les arbres sup\u00e9rieur et inf\u00e9rieur de la sph\u00e8re et le couple de fonctionnement est faible, ce qui convient aux vannes haute pression et de grand diam\u00e8tre.<\/p>\n\n\n\n<div class=\"wp-block-columns is-layout-flex wp-container-core-columns-is-layout-9d6595d7 wp-block-columns-is-layout-flex\">\n<div class=\"wp-block-column is-layout-flow wp-block-column-is-layout-flow\"><div class=\"wp-block-image\">\n<figure class=\"aligncenter size-full is-resized\"><img loading=\"lazy\" decoding=\"async\" src=\"https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104945.jpg\" alt=\"Robinet \u00e0 tournant sph\u00e9rique en acier moul\u00e9\" class=\"wp-image-17518\" width=\"400\" height=\"300\" srcset=\"https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104945.jpg 800w, https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104945-300x225.jpg 300w, https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104945-768x576.jpg 768w, https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104945-600x450.jpg 600w\" sizes=\"auto, (max-width: 400px) 100vw, 400px\" \/><figcaption>Robinet \u00e0 tournant sph\u00e9rique en acier moul\u00e9<\/figcaption><\/figure>\n<\/div><\/div>\n\n\n\n<div class=\"wp-block-column is-layout-flow wp-block-column-is-layout-flow\"><div class=\"wp-block-image\">\n<figure class=\"aligncenter size-full is-resized\"><img loading=\"lazy\" decoding=\"async\" src=\"https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104749.jpg\" alt=\"Robinet \u00e0 tournant sph\u00e9rique en acier forg\u00e9\" class=\"wp-image-17511\" width=\"400\" height=\"300\" srcset=\"https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104749.jpg 800w, https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104749-300x225.jpg 300w, https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104749-768x576.jpg 768w, https:\/\/zecovalve.com\/wp-content\/uploads\/2022\/06\/F-2-104749-600x450.jpg 600w\" sizes=\"auto, (max-width: 400px) 100vw, 400px\" \/><figcaption>Robinet \u00e0 tournant sph\u00e9rique en acier forg\u00e9<\/figcaption><\/figure>\n<\/div><\/div>\n<\/div>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"h-1-2-trunnion-mounted-ball-valve-assembly\">1.2 Ensemble de robinet \u00e0 tournant sph\u00e9rique mont\u00e9 sur tourillon<\/h3>\n\n\n\n<p>La vanne est g\u00e9n\u00e9ralement assembl\u00e9e avec le corps de vanne comme pi\u00e8ce de r\u00e9f\u00e9rence, dans l&#039;ordre et la m\u00e9thode sp\u00e9cifi\u00e9s par le processus. Une fois l&#039;assemblage final r\u00e9alis\u00e9, le m\u00e9canisme de commande doit \u00eatre tourn\u00e9 pour v\u00e9rifier si le mouvement des pi\u00e8ces d&#039;ouverture et de fermeture de la vanne est mobile et s&#039;il y a un blocage.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"h-1-3-trunnion-ball-valve-design\">1.3 Conception du robinet \u00e0 tournant sph\u00e9rique<\/h3>\n\n\n\n<p>Le robinet \u00e0 tournant sph\u00e9rique \u00e0 tourillon adopte un noyau de vanne fixe \u00e0 tige sup\u00e9rieure et inf\u00e9rieure (type de support d&#039;arbre) et une conception de si\u00e8ge d&#039;\u00e9tanch\u00e9it\u00e9 mobile, qui est plus stable en fonctionnement. Avec la fonction de compensation automatique, il existe une grande force de cisaillement et une fonction autonettoyante lorsqu&#039;il n&#039;y a pas d&#039;espace entre le si\u00e8ge de la vanne d&#039;\u00e9tanch\u00e9it\u00e9 bidirectionnelle. Il est particuli\u00e8rement adapt\u00e9 \u00e0 l&#039;on-off de fibres, de suspensions contenant de minuscules particules solides et de milieux visqueux.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"h-1-4-trunnion-mounted-ball-valve-characteristics-and-performance\">1.4 Caract\u00e9ristiques et performances des robinets \u00e0 tournant sph\u00e9rique mont\u00e9s sur tourillon<\/h3>\n\n\n\n<p>Les robinets \u00e0 tournant sph\u00e9rique mont\u00e9s sur tourillon conviennent \u00e0 diverses canalisations de moyenne et haute pression. Ils sont utilis\u00e9s pour couper ou connecter le fluide dans le pipeline. Diff\u00e9rents mat\u00e9riaux sont s\u00e9lectionn\u00e9s. Ils peuvent \u00eatre appliqu\u00e9s respectivement \u00e0 l&#039;eau, \u00e0 la vapeur, au p\u00e9trole, au gaz liqu\u00e9fi\u00e9, au gaz naturel, au gaz, \u00e0 l&#039;acide nitrique, \u00e0 l&#039;acide ac\u00e9tique, au milieu oxydant, \u00e0 l&#039;ur\u00e9e et \u00e0 d&#039;autres milieux. Ils sont largement utilis\u00e9s dans l\u2019industrie p\u00e9trochimique, l\u2019\u00e9nergie \u00e9lectrique, la conservation de l\u2019eau et d\u2019autres industries. Les modes de conduite courants des vannes \u00e0 bille mont\u00e9es sur tourillon sont l&#039;entra\u00eenement par roue \u00e0 vis sans fin, manuel, \u00e9lectrique et pneumatique. La plupart des robinets \u00e0 tournant sph\u00e9rique mont\u00e9s sur tourillon sont brid\u00e9s, mais il existe \u00e9galement des robinets \u00e0 tournant sph\u00e9rique mont\u00e9s sur tourillon sous forme soud\u00e9e.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"h-2-ball-valve-floating-type\">2. Il est fortement recommand\u00e9 de remplacer le si\u00e8ge de soupape et le joint de couvercle de soupape par un kit de pi\u00e8ces d\u00e9tach\u00e9es.\u00a0<\/p>\n\n\n\n<p>(2)Assembler dans l&#039;ordre inverse du d\u00e9montage.&nbsp;<\/p>\n\n\n\n<p>(3) Serrez l&#039;\u00e9crou de tige en utilisant le couple sp\u00e9cifi\u00e9.&nbsp;<\/p>\n\n\n\n<p>(4) Apr\u00e8s avoir install\u00e9 le m\u00e9canisme de commande, entrez le signal correspondant pour faire tourner le noyau de la vanne en faisant tourner la tige de la vanne pour mettre la vanne en position ouverte et ferm\u00e9e.&nbsp;<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"h-2-3-floating-ball-valve-design\">2.3 Conception du robinet \u00e0 tournant sph\u00e9rique flottant<\/h3>\n\n\n\n<p>Le robinet \u00e0 tournant sph\u00e9rique flottant a une structure simple et de bonnes performances d&#039;\u00e9tanch\u00e9it\u00e9. Cependant, la charge de la sph\u00e8re qui supporte le fluide de travail est enti\u00e8rement transmise \u00e0 la bague d&#039;\u00e9tanch\u00e9it\u00e9 de sortie. Par cons\u00e9quent, il est n\u00e9cessaire de d\u00e9terminer si le mat\u00e9riau de la bague d\u2019\u00e9tanch\u00e9it\u00e9 peut r\u00e9sister \u00e0 la charge de travail du milieu sph\u00e9rique. Lorsqu&#039;elle est soumise \u00e0 une pression plus \u00e9lev\u00e9e, la sph\u00e8re peut se d\u00e9placer. De ce fait, cette structure est g\u00e9n\u00e9ralement utilis\u00e9e pour les robinets \u00e0 tournant sph\u00e9rique moyenne et basse pression.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\" id=\"h-2-4-floating-ball-valve-characteristics-and-performance\">2.4 Caract\u00e9ristiques et performances des robinets \u00e0 tournant sph\u00e9rique flottant<\/h3>\n\n\n\n<p>Les caract\u00e9ristiques g\u00e9n\u00e9rales du type flottant \u00e0 robinet \u00e0 tournant sph\u00e9rique sont une petite taille, un poids l\u00e9ger, une structure simple et une sph\u00e8re avec une fonction flottante pour mieux assurer l&#039;\u00e9tanch\u00e9it\u00e9.
